How much do predictive analytics internship j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for predictive analytics internship in the United States is $17.31,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$19.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What types of projects can I expect to work on during a Predictive Analytics Internship?

As a Predictive Analytics Intern, you can expect to work on projects that involve collecting, cleaning, and analyzing large datasets to identify trends and make forecasts. Typical responsibilities may include building statistical models, developing machine learning algorithms, and presenting actionable insights to business stakeholders. You will likely collaborate with data scientists, engineers, and business analysts, gaining hands-on experience with real-world data challenges in a supportive team environment. These projects not only help build technical skills but also provide exposure to how data-driven decisions are made in the organization.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Predictive Analytics Int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Predictive Analytics Intern, you need strong quantitative skills, knowledge of statistics, and experience with data analysis, often supported by coursework in mathematics, computer science, or related fields. Familiarity with tools such as Python, R, SQL, and machine learning libraries, as well as experience using data visualization platforms like Tableau, is typically expected. Anal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help interns present complex findings clearly and collaborate with team members. These abilities are critical for transforming data into actionable insights that drive decision-making in real business contexts.

What is the difference between Predictive Analytics Internship vs Data Analyst Internship?

AspectPredictive Analytics InternshipData Analyst Internship
Required SkillsStatistical modeling, programming (Python, R), data visualizationData cleaning, SQL, Excel, basic statistics
Work EnvironmentAnalytics teams, data science departmentsBusiness units, reporting teams
Industry UsageTech, finance, marketingRetail, healthcare, finance

Predictive Analytics Internships focus on building models to forecast future trends using statistical and machine learning techniques. Data Analyst Internships emphasize data cleaning, analysis, and reporting to support business decisions. Both roles require analytical skills, but predictive analytics internships often demand more advanced statistical knowledge and programming experience.

What is a Predictive Analytics Internship?

A Predictive Analytics Internship is a temporary position, usually for students or recent graduates, that provides hands-on experience in analyzing data to forecast trends and outcomes. Interns work with datasets, statistical models, and machine learning tools to help organizations make data-driven decisions. The internship typically involves tasks like data cleaning, building predictive models, and interpreting results under the guidance of experienced analysts or data scientists. This role helps interns develop practical skills in analytics, programming, and business intelligence.
